10 cities that aren't on your bucket list (but should be)

Bundi, Rajasthan: Strike up a conversation with local artisans creating intricate handicrafts. Experience the warmth of Rajasthani hospitality by sharing chai with the locals.

Gokarna, Karnataka: Join locals in their daily routines, from shopping at the vibrant markets to attending temple ceremonies. Engage in conversations with fishermen about their life by the sea.

Hampi, Karnataka: Connect with local guides who breathe life into the ancient ruins with their stories. Share a meal with fellow travelers, bonding over the mesmerizing landscapes.

Bishnupur, West Bengal: Attend a traditional music performance and chat with locals about the cultural significance of their crafts. Explore the town with a local guide for a deeper understanding.

Chanderi, Madhya Pradesh: Visit the local weavers, learn about the art of creating Chanderi sarees, and perhaps try your hand at the loom. Engage with locals in the bustling markets.

Mandawa, Rajasthan: Join a walking tour with a local guide who narrates tales of the painted havelis. Share laughter and stories with the welcoming locals.

Lansdowne, Uttarakhand: Attend a local festival or fair, interact with families picnicking in the hills, and immerse yourself in the tranquility of this lesser-known hill station.

Mahabalipuram, Tamil Nadu: Visit a coastal village and learn about the traditional fishing methods. Engage with locals in the bustling market, tasting the flavors of the region.

Bhandardara, Maharashtra: Explore the village with a local guide, understanding the symbiotic relationship between the villagers and nature. Share moments of serenity by the lakeside.

Pelling, Sikkim: Join a prayer session in a local monastery, converse with monks about their daily lives, and savor traditional Sikkimese dishes in a homely setting.

